Abstract:
Objective To analyze the effects of Jigsaw teaching model based on virtual learning community on improving the deep learning ability of undergraduate midwifery students.
Methods Fifty-nine midwifery students in 2021 were divdied into the control group (29 students taught with Jigsaw teaching model) and observation group (30 students taught with Jigsaw teaching model based on virtual learning community). The teaching effect was evaluated through the course assessment performance, self-compiled course satisfaction evaluation form and deep learning ability questionnaire.
Results The usual score of the observation group was significantly higher than that of control group (P < 0.05), and there was no statistical sinificance in the theoretical and comprehensive scores between two groups (P > 0.05). The scores of cooperation ability, critical thinking ability, independent learning ability and innovative thinking ability in the observation group were higher than those in control group (P < 0.05), but there was no statistical significance in the communication ability and learning perseverance between two groups (P > 0.05). There was no statistical significance in their satisfaction with teaching level and learning evaluation process (P > 0.05), but the differences of their satisfaction with teaching resources and learning harvest were statistically significant between two groups (P < 0.05).
Conclusions The Jigsaw cooperative learning based on virtual learning community can improve the students' daily performance, and promote the improvement of students' deep learning ability, such as collaboration ability, independent learning ability, critical thinking ability and innovation ability.
